How did the framers plan to resolve conflicts that might arise between the states and the national government?

The framers of the Constitution planned to resolve conflicts between the states and the national government primarily through the Supremacy Clause, which establishes that federal law takes precedence over state law. They also created a system of checks and balances to ensure that power was distributed among the branches of government, allowing for judicial review by the Supreme Court to interpret laws and resolve disputes. Additionally, the framers included mechanisms for amending the Constitution to adapt to changing circumstances, further providing a framework for conflict resolution.

Hawks vs. Doves?

Popularly, "hawks" are those who advocate an aggressive foreign policy based on strong military power. "Doves" try to resolve international conflicts without the threat of force.
